Christmas message from Fr. Luigi Moroni


RHYL ROTARY A call for people to forget about themselves and instead to think of the needs of others was the Christmas message delivered to members of Rhyl Rotary Club at their annual Yuletide dinner at Faenol Fawr. Introduced by President Mike Parry, guest speaker Father Luigi Moroni, of Holywell, at 27 the youngest Roman Catholic Parish Priest in North Wales, said that using this special time of year to turn away from one’s own wants and to focus on the opportunity to be of service and help to those around us, would better reflect what was the true challenge of Christmas. An Italian, who has lived in Wales for the past 8 years, Father Luigi said he was a member of a Vocational order of priests dedicated to this objective and ideal. For this reason he was much attracted to Rotary’s own international theme for the year, inviting members everywhere “to make yourselves a gift in the world.” The warm thanks of the club for such a timely and appropriate address were expressed by President Mike who also warmly welcomed the presence of numerous wives and friends who had come along for this special occasion. After presenting a cheque for £200 in support of the Young Musicians concert organized in the coming season by Rhyl Music Club, to member Rufus Adams, an official of the Music Club, the President announced that the next meeting would take place on January 5. Meanwhile, he wished all present and their families a most peaceful Christmas and a healthy and rewarding new year.
